Transaction 529beb686a4c3d6f5b63dca83226d3e3f41e77d6e75271d40a01a51714da8bf9
1 Input
2 Outputs
- 529beb686a4c3d6f5b63dca83226d3e3f41e77d6e75271d40a01a51714da8bf9:0
- 529beb686a4c3d6f5b63dca83226d3e3f41e77d6e75271d40a01a51714da8bf9:1
value 95343787
address 1CHdWFQ3T6jws1XZZbodipVRBJdH9PuAm3
value 1123000
address 1NYV1pQcEkg5ogSykeSYCnxkQD62Ha7WGt